There is no one date on which the PPET is held for JSGPP MA admissions. Instead, candidates who apply for the exam are required to choose one date from a set of dates provided by the institute after registrations. The candidates can choose the date most suitable for them alongside the date for the personal interview round.

Yes, it is quite possible to get admission to BE/ BTech at Chitkara University Institute of Engineering and Technology without JEE Mains but students are required to pass class 12/ Diploma in a relevant field with at least 70% aggregate. While the selections will now be done based on Personal Interviews only.

Jindal School of Government and Public Policy offers admission to candidates based on their entrance exam scores. Aspirants need to pass SAT, ACT, CUET or JSAT for admission to UG programmes. The school accepts PPET scores for MA programme. Selected candidates also need to pass the personal interview round. Hence, candidates must pass the entrance exam for admission at Jindal School of Government and Public Policy.

 Candidates can start the application process of ULET exam as per the steps below

Go to uniraj.ac.in
Click on ULET 2026 at the bottom of the page
A new tab will open up
Start filling the application form
Next, candidates need to pay the application fee INR 1200 through UPI
Submit the form
Take a print out
